Abstract: Objective: To explore the effect of constructing nutritional nursing mode basing on nurses' nutritional risk screening of hospitalized patients. Methods: According to current situation of nutritional care, we gradually built nutritional care model of hospitalized patients, including establishing clinical nutrition care team, training nurses, designing related forms and guidelines about nutritional risk screening, editing 'Clinical nutrition care knowledge manual', making flow chart about nutrition care, and cooperating with multiple disciplines. Results: After implementation of the mode, clinical nurses' nutrition knowledge level was improved (P<0.01). Meanwhile, the use of enteral nutrition preparations and the number of nutrition consultation increased obviously and hospitalized patients' satisfaction to nurses' nutrition guidance improved (P<0.01). Conclusion: We have initially established the nutritional nursing mode of hospitalized patents, that is 'nutritional risk screening after admission—nutritional evaluation—nutritional intervention—effect evaluation'. With two years' practice, it has achieved good results in improving clinical outcomes and the quality of nursing and it is worth generalizing in clinic.
